- The distance between Dakhla, Egypt and Strasbourg, France is approximately 3,164 km or 1,966 mi.
- To reach Dakhla in this distance one would set out from Strasbourg bearing 136.4°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Dakhla bearing 149.6° or SSE .
- Dakhla has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Strasbourg has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Dakhla is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Strasbourg is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 12.8 °C (23°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.4 °C (0.7°F) more in Dakhla. The continentality subtype is semicont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 607 mm (23.9 in) less which is equivalent to 607 l/m² (14.9 US gal/ft²) or 6,070,000 l/ha (648,923 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23° higher in Dakhla than in Strasbourg.
- Relative humidity levels are 46%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 0.9°C (1.6°F) lower.
